Output 345978efc60e6ce60e66174b575614dcf1bcc1179a914f833d35cde8f70488bd:10

value
129332572
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3460d28ec5213c6e2eac926c48144704f914f5b1 OP_EQUAL
address
MCg7MkTCGf28NyjB8oaTjka7ECFJt6uwCt
transaction
345978efc60e6ce60e66174b575614dcf1bcc1179a914f833d35cde8f70488bd
spent
true